27 //===--------------------------------------------------------------------===//
29 // createGlobalsModRefPass - This pass provides alias and mod/ref info for
30 // global values that do not have their addresses taken.
32 Pass *createGlobalsModRefPass();
34 //===--------------------------------------------------------------------===//
36 // createAAEvalPass - This pass implements a simple N^2 alias analysis
37 // accuracy evaluator.
39 FunctionPass *createAAEvalPass();
41 //===--------------------------------------------------------------------===//
43 // createNoAAPass - This pass implements a "I don't know" alias analysis.
45 ImmutablePass *createNoAAPass();
47 //===--------------------------------------------------------------------===//
49 // createScalarEvolutionAliasAnalysisPass - This pass implements a simple
50 // alias analysis using ScalarEvolution queries.
52 FunctionPass *createScalarEvolutionAliasAnalysisPass();
54 //===--------------------------------------------------------------------===//
56 // createTypeBasedAliasAnalysisPass - This pass implements metadata-based
57 // type-based alias analysis.
59 ImmutablePass *createTypeBasedAliasAnalysisPass();
